As
water
enters
the
washer
and
the
level
begins
to rise, it
f1ow~
into
the
air
dome.
This
creates
pressure
on the
diaphragm
through
the
air
tube. When
the
water
reaches
a
predetermined
level,
the
pressure
is
sufficient
to
over-
come
the
pressure
exerted
on the
diaphragm
by the
pressure
switch. As
the
diaphragm
rises, the
electrical
contact
arm
is
moved
from
"Fill"
to the
"Run"
position.
As
water
is
drained
from
the
washer
during
spin,
water
is
also
drained
from
the
air
dome,
lowering
air
pressure
in
the
air
tube.
This
allows
the
switch
contact
to
reset
to
the
"Fill"
position.
If
the
setting
of MEDIUM
or
SMALL
is
used,
there
is less
pressure
applied
to
the
tension
bar,
resulting
in
a
decreased
amount
of
air
pressure
required
to
trip
the
contact
arm
to the
"Run"
position.

As
the level
indicator
is
raised,
a
tapered
cam
on the
back
side
of
the
indicator
comes
in
contact
with
an
arm
which
pushes
against
the
diaphragm.
When the level
indicator
is
pushed
all
the
way
up
(to a
point
where
resistance
is
met) the
maximum
pressure
is
applied
to
the
diaphragm
and
it
will
take
a
full
tub
of
water
to
overcome
the
pressure
applied
to the
pressure
switch,
moving
it
from
"Fill"
to
the
"Run"
position.
The
amount
of
water
in
the
tub
is
selected
by
moving
the
level
indicator
to
the
desired
level
on
the legend. The
large
capacity
model
may
be set on
Small,
Medium,
Large
or
any
place
between.
The
extra
large
capacity
model
may
be set on Ex-Small, Small,
Medium,
Large,
Extra-Large,
or
any
place
between.
When
the
level
indicator
is
in
the
down
position,
there
is no
pressure
on the
diaphragm
inside
the
pressure
switch.
